Overview
The Management programme from Management and Science University is designed for those who want to build a career in management. The curriculum takes a detailed analytical approach, enabling you to critically evaluate current trends and theories in management. You will attain a sound understanding of the social, economic, and political factors that affect organizations worldwide.
Through the MSU Global Mobility Programme, you will broaden your technical skills as a manager and use the insights gained from the programme in coming up with real-world and practical managerial decisions. You will graduate armed with a strong background in the theoretical and practical elements in management, ready to meet new and challenging demands in the fast-paced business world.

Other requirements
General requirements
Bachelor’s degree (MQF Level 6) with 2.75 CGPA or equivalent as accepted by MSU Senate; CGPAs below 2.75 but above 2.50 may be accepted subject to rigorous internal assessment; CGPAs below 2.50 may be accepted subject to presenting five (5) years working experience in a relevant field.
